Angela Gossow Urach
Angela Gossow, born in Cologne to Christian parents, was the youngest of three siblings and brothers. Angela Gossow was seventeen when her parents divorced. Additional financial problems came about when the company they owned went under. Bulimia and anorexic eating added to her woes. Gossow spoke very openly in her explanation of why she decided to quit ARCH Enemy's band as their vocalist. She explained, "There's a place and time for every thing." Alissa Wire-Gluz (/@'liz/ (born July 31 1985) is the name of a Canadian female vocalist. She's best known for her work as lead vocalist in the Swedish metalcore group Arch Enemy, and was the founding vocalist and original lead of Canadian metalcore outfit the Agonist.
